What OpexMX Dashboard Builder Does

Lets you compose your own dashboards from live maintenance data — widget by widget — or describe what you want in plain language and let AI assemble a first draft.

Widget Types

Line, bar, area, stacked-bar, pie, donut, scatter, metric, table, gauge, text, and an AI-insight widget that writes the takeaway for you.

Real Data Sources

Widgets bind to real endpoints — work orders, assets, inventory, downtime, MTBF/MTTR, personnel and PM performance, parts stock, energy consumption, carbon footprint, and sustainability. Data is fetched in-process through the API adapter (no raw SQL, no credentials leaked to the model).

AI, Three Ways

  • Generate — describe the dashboard in plain language (optionally attach a photo of a chart or SOP); AI returns a validated plan of up to six widgets. It can only use fields that exist, so no invented metrics.
  • Co-edit — an iterative editor: ask for changes in natural language and the agent adds, updates, or removes widgets, streaming each edit live.
  • Insight — point it at a widget and get a three-sentence narrative: what and where (with numbers), who and when, and one corrective action.

Layout

Drag widgets onto a grid (column/row/span), reorder, and save. Default dashboards ship out of the box.

How It Works

  1. Pick a data source for a widget (or let AI choose).
  2. Configure grouping, aggregation (count/sum/avg/min/max), field, time bucket, and filters.
  3. Choose a chart type and place it on the grid.
  4. Ask the AI to generate, co-edit, or explain — at any step.
  5. Save the dashboard; share the view with your team.
